Colm O hEigeartaigh resolved CXF-6110. -------------------------------------- Resolution: Fixed > AbstractSTSClient MEX: download XML schema from Location > -------------------------------------------------------- > > Key: CXF-6110 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CXF-6110 > Project: CXF > Issue Type: Improvement > Components: STS > Affects Versions: 2.7.13 > Reporter: Frank Cornelis > Assignee: Colm O hEigeartaigh > Fix For: 3.1.0, 3.0.3, 2.7.14 > > > For MEX data like: > {code:xml} > <MetadataSection > Dialect="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" > Identifier="http://something"> > <Location>https://some/location.xsd</Location> > </MetadataSection> > {code} > the AbstractSTSClient should probably start downloading when getAny() gives > NULL. > I stumbled upon this by implementing a WS-Trust STS with a WSDL that contains > schema imports instead of an embedded XML schema. > The next patch adds this feature (quick and dirty). > {code} > --- > src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/ws/security/trust/AbstractSTSClient.java.orig > 2014-11-19 17:49:37.964705313 +0100 > +++ src/main/java/org/apache/cxf/ws/security/trust/AbstractSTSClient.java > 2014-11-19 18:19:01.989607217 +0100 > @@ -41,6 +41,9 @@ > import javax.wsdl.extensions.ExtensibilityElement; > import javax.wsdl.extensions.schema.Schema; > import javax.xml.namespace.QName; > +import javax.xml.parsers.DocumentBuilder; > +import javax.xml.parsers.DocumentBuilderFactory; > +import javax.xml.parsers.ParserConfigurationException; > import javax.xml.stream.XMLStreamException; > import javax.xml.stream.XMLStreamWriter; > import javax.xml.transform.dom.DOMSource; > @@ -48,6 +51,7 @@ > import org.w3c.dom.Document; > import org.w3c.dom.Element; > import org.w3c.dom.Node; > +import org.xml.sax.SAXException; > import org.apache.cxf.Bus; > import org.apache.cxf.BusException; > import org.apache.cxf.binding.soap.SoapBindingConstants; > @@ -525,6 +529,11 @@ > > bus.getExtension(WSDLManager.class).getDefinition((Element)s.getAny()); > } else if > ("http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ema".equals(s.getDialect())) { > Element schemaElement = (Element)s.getAny(); > + if (schemaElement == null) { > + String schemaLocation = s.getLocation(); > + LOG.info("XSD schema location: " + > schemaLocation); > + schemaElement = downloadSchema(schemaLocation); > + } > QName schemaName = > new QName(schemaElement.getNamespaceURI(), > schemaElement.getLocalName()); > WSDLManager wsdlManager = > bus.getExtension(WSDLManager.class); > @@ -586,10 +595,20 @@ > client = new ClientImpl(bus, endpoint); > } > } catch (Exception ex) { > - throw new TrustException(LOG, "WS_MEX_ERROR", ex); > + throw new TrustException("WS_MEX_ERROR", LOG, ex); > } > } > } > + > + private Element downloadSchema(String schemaLocation) > + throws ParserConfigurationException, SAXException, IOException { > + DocumentBuilderFactory documentBuilderFactory = > DocumentBuilderFactory.newInstance(); > + documentBuilderFactory.setNamespaceAware(true); > + DocumentBuilder documentBuilder = > documentBuilderFactory.newDocumentBuilder(); > + Document document = documentBuilder.parse(schemaLocation); > + return document.getDocumentElement(); > + } > + > protected String findMEXLocation(EndpointReferenceType ref, boolean > useEPRWSAAddrAsMEXLocation) { > if (ref.getMetadata() != null && ref.getMetadata().getAny() != null) > { > for (Object any : ref.getMetadata().getAny()) { > {code} -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.3.4#6332)
